Souper Salad Restaurants Mesa - Hours & Locations

1

Souper Salad Restaurants - Mesa

1457 W Southern Ave, #107, Mesa AZ 85202 Phone Number:(480) 644-9566
  1. Store Hours

Hours may fluctuate

Distance:3.11 miles
Edit
2

Souper Salad Restaurants - Mesa

6910 E Hampton Ave, Mesa AZ 85209 Phone Number:(480) 832-3389
  1. Store Hours

Hours may fluctuate

Distance:8.38 miles
Edit
3

Souper Salad Restaurants - Tempe

1180 W Elliot Rd, #101, Tempe AZ 85284 Phone Number:(480) 491-8008
  1. Store Hours

Hours may fluctuate

Distance:9.35 miles
Edit
4

Souper Salad Restaurants - Phoenix

2651 N 44th St, #2, Phoenix AZ 85008 Phone Number:(602) 840-5686
  1. Store Hours

Hours may fluctuate

Distance:10.27 miles
Edit
5

Souper Salad Restaurants - Phoenix

2045 E Camelback Rd, Phoenix AZ 85016 Phone Number:(602) 955-6844
  1. Store Hours

Hours may fluctuate

Distance:13.87 miles
Edit
6

Souper Salad Restaurants - Phoenix

4605 E Cactus Rd, Phoenix AZ 85032 Phone Number:(602) 494-7656
  1. Store Hours

Hours may fluctuate

Distance:15.39 miles
Edit
7

Souper Salad Restaurants - Phoenix

10005 N Metro Pky E, Phoenix AZ 85051 Phone Number:(602) 678-5466
  1. Store Hours

Hours may fluctuate

Distance:20.17 miles
Edit